Legal Frameworks Governing Border Security and Data Privacy

Legal frameworks governing border security and data privacy form the foundation for balancing effective national security measures with the protection of individual rights. These frameworks consist of a mix of domestic laws, treaties, and international standards that regulate data collection, processing, and sharing at borders.

In the United States, laws such as the Immigration and Nationality Act and the Privacy Act establish rules for border data handling, while international agreements like the Schengen Agreement influence data transfer protocols. Additionally, global standards such as the General Data Protection Regulation (GDPR) in the European Union significantly impact border security practices, especially for data processed involving international travelers.

Legal structures must ensure law enforcement agencies can utilize advanced technologies like biometric identification while maintaining privacy rights. The ongoing development of these legal frameworks reflects the need for clarity, accountability, and transparency in border security and data privacy laws, adapting to technological advances and evolving security threats.

Passport and Visa Data Management

Passport and visa data management involves systematically collecting, storing, and processing travelers’ personal information essential for border crossing. Governments rely on this data to verify identities and ensure national security. These practices are governed by strict legal standards to protect privacy rights while maintaining effective border control.

Typically, passport data includes biometric identifiers, such as photographs and fingerprint information, along with personal details like name, date of birth, and nationality. Visa data management extends this by recording additional information related to the purpose of travel, duration, and consent. This data is stored securely in centralized databases accessible to border security authorities.

Legal frameworks around passport and visa data management emphasize data accuracy, security, and privacy protections. International standards, such as those set by the International Civil Aviation Organization (ICAO), facilitate interoperability while safeguarding travelers’ rights. Balancing data security with privacy concerns remains a core component of effective border security law.

Surveillance Technologies and Data Retention Policies

Surveillance technologies play a pivotal role in border security by enabling authorities to monitor crossings, identify threats, and maintain safety. Common tools include biometric scanners, CCTV cameras, and advanced data analytics systems. These technologies facilitate rapid identification and processing of travelers, thereby reinforcing border safety measures.

Data retention policies are integral to the legal framework governing these surveillance practices. They specify the duration for which collected data, such as biometric information, facial images, and surveillance footage, can be stored. Often, policies are dictated by national security requirements, data protection laws, and operational needs.

Key aspects of data retention policies include:

  1. Duration of storage periods—ranging from months to several years.
  2. Criteria for data deletion or anonymization after a specified timeframe.
  3. Procedures for secure data management to prevent unauthorized access.

Adherence to these policies is subject to legal scrutiny and privacy considerations, balancing the necessity for security with the rights of individuals.
